SGD与HMM驱动在线学习,提升计算机视觉与语音识别精度
人工智能首页 > AI学习 > 正文

SGD与HMM驱动在线学习,提升计算机视觉与语音识别精度

2025-03-06 阅读34次

在人工智能快速发展的今天,计算机视觉和语音识别作为两大支柱性技术,正在深刻改变我们的生活方式。无论是智能摄像头的实时监控,还是智能音箱的语音交互,这些技术的应用场景已经渗透到生活的方方面面。然而,在实际应用中,如何在动态变化的环境中保持模型的高精度和实时性,依然是一个巨大的挑战。近年来,随机梯度下降(SGD)和隐马尔可夫模型(HMM)的结合,在线学习技术的突破,为这一问题提供了一个全新的解决方案。


人工智能,AI学习,计算机视觉检测,SGD优化器,隐马尔可夫模型,在线学习,语音识别模型

在线学习:人工智能的实时进化

在线学习(Online Learning)是一种能够实时更新模型参数的学习方式。与传统的批量学习(Batch Learning)不同,在线学习不需要等待所有数据加载完毕,而是通过不断接收新的数据,逐步优化模型。这种学习方式特别适合处理动态变化的场景,例如实时视频流分析或语音交互系统。

在计算机视觉领域,传统的批量学习方法在面对动态场景时往往表现不佳。例如,在智能交通系统中,摄像头需要实时检测和识别道路上的车辆、行人和交通标志。如果模型无法快速适应光线变化、车辆遮挡等动态因素,其检测精度将大幅下降。在线学习技术的引入,使得模型能够实时更新,从而在动态环境中保持高精度。

在语音识别领域,在线学习同样具有重要意义。语音识别系统需要在实时对话中快速识别用户的指令或问题。如果模型无法及时适应用户的口音、语速或背景噪声的变化,识别结果将难以满足实际需求。通过在线学习,语音识别模型能够实时更新,从而提供更加精准的识别服务。

SGD:优化在线学习的关键

随机梯度下降(SGD)是在线学习中广泛使用的优化算法。与批量梯度下降(Batch Gradient Descent)不同,SGD通过每次仅使用一个样本或一小批样本更新模型参数,从而大大提高了计算效率。SGD的核心思想是通过不断迭代,逐步逼近模型参数的最优解。

在在线学习中,SGD的优势更加明显。由于在线学习需要处理实时数据流,使用批量梯度下降会因为计算时间过长而无法满足实时性要求。而SGD通过每次仅更新一部分参数,能够在有限的时间内完成模型更新,从而保证系统的实时性。

SGD的另一个重要优势是其能够处理非凸优化问题。在深度学习中,模型的损失函数往往是非凸的,存在多个局部最优解。通过调整学习率和优化策略,SGD能够在一定程度上跳出局部最优解,找到更好的参数组合。

HMM:捕捉序列数据的动态本质

隐马尔可夫模型(HMM)是一种广泛应用于序列数据分析的经典模型。HMM通过隐藏状态和观测状态的转移概率,能够捕捉序列数据中的动态变化规律。在语音识别和自然语言处理等领域,HMM一直是重要的核心技术。

在在线学习中,HMM的优势在于其能够处理时间序列数据的动态变化。例如,在语音识别中,用户的语音输入是一个时间序列,每个时刻的语音特征都会受到前一个时刻的影响。HMM通过建模这种时间依赖性,能够更好地捕捉语音特征的变化规律,从而提高识别精度。

在计算机视觉领域,HMM同样具有重要的应用价值。例如,在视频分析中,HMM可以通过建模视频帧之间的动态变化,捕捉目标物体的运动轨迹,从而实现更精准的目标检测和跟踪。

融合SGD与HMM:提升精度与实时性

将SGD与HMM结合起来,可以进一步提升在线学习的精度和实时性。SGD通过优化模型参数,能够快速适应数据的变化;而HMM通过建模序列数据的动态变化,能够捕捉数据中的复杂规律。两者的结合,不仅能够提高模型的精度,还能够保证模型的实时性。

在计算机视觉领域,SGD与HMM的结合可以用于实时视频分析。例如,在智能安防系统中,通过HMM建模视频帧之间的动态变化,可以捕捉目标物体的运动轨迹;通过SGD优化模型参数,可以实时更新模型,适应光照变化和目标遮挡等复杂场景。这种结合方式,不仅可以提高目标检测的精度,还能够保证系统的实时性。

在语音识别领域,SGD与HMM的结合同样具有重要意义。通过HMM建模语音特征的时间依赖性,可以捕捉语音信号中的动态变化规律;通过SGD优化模型参数,可以实时更新模型,适应用户的语速、口音和背景噪声的变化。这种结合方式,不仅可以提高语音识别的精度,还能够提供更加个性化的识别服务。

未来展望:在线学习的无限可能

随着人工智能技术的不断发展,在线学习技术的应用场景将越来越广泛。无论是计算机视觉还是语音识别,在线学习都将在提升模型精度和实时性方面发挥重要作用。SGD与HMM的结合,不仅为在线学习提供了一个全新的解决方案,还为人工智能技术的未来发展提供了无限可能。

在未来,随着5G网络和边缘计算技术的普及,在线学习技术将更加广泛地应用于实时数据处理和智能决策领域。例如,在智能驾驶系统中,在线学习技术可以通过实时处理传感器数据,快速更新模型参数,从而提高驾驶系统的安全性;在智能医疗系统中,在线学习技术可以通过实时处理患者的生理数据,快速更新诊断模型,从而提高诊断的准确性。

总之,在线学习技术的突破,不仅能够提升计算机视觉和语音识别的精度和实时性,还能够为人工智能技术的未来发展提供更加广阔的空间。

作者声明:内容由AI生成

随意打赏
WeixinPathErWeiMaHtml
ZhifubaoPathErWeiMaHtml